How To Choose the Most Suitable Apartments in Memphis, TN
Set Your Budget
Decide how much money you can spend. Think about
rent, bills, and other costs. Look for apartments near Memphis, TN, that
fit your budget. Some places offer special deals that help you save money.
Compare apartment prices in different areas to make sure they match what you
can afford. Remember to add extra for things like water, trash, and parking.
Always keep some money aside for surprises.

Pick the Right Neighborhood
Think about where you want to live. Explore
places like apartments on S Avalon or neighborhoods near Memphis with stores,
schools, and parks. A good location makes life easier. Choose a place close to
your work or school. Find safe areas with friendly neighbors. Check if the
place has fun activities nearby or if you can easily get around.

Look for Safe Spots
Check how safe the area feels. Walk around at
different times of the day. Bright lights, cameras, and gates can make a place
feel safer. Look at crime maps or talk to neighbors to learn more about the
area. See if the apartment has things like good lighting and security guards.
These features help you feel more secure at home.
